Keen San Jose CA
Add Website
Close
Keen
Be first to review 2400 Forest Ave,San Jose CA 95128 Phone Number: (408) 248-2180
Keen Store Hours
Hours may fluctuate
Post a review
Keen Nearby
Locations Closest to You miles-
Keen - Santa Clara 2855 STEVENS CREEK BLVD, #13610.11
-
Keen - Santa Clara 2855 STEVENS CREEK BLVD0.11
-
Keen - San Jose 377 SANTANA ROW STE 10150.38